Description
Club Esportiu Campanet is a sports club and community sports centre on the edge of the small village of Campanet in the north of Mallorca.
Sports Facilities & Activities
The club includes football sections as well as a range of other sports. Facilities comprise a football pitch, padel courts and a swimming pool — the latter well maintained and popular with visitors. A swimming cap is required to use the pool and can be hired or purchased on site. The facilities as a whole are kept in excellent condition.
Bar, Café & Refreshments
The sports centre has its own bar and café. As well as snacks and breakfast, a Sunday set menu is on offer. Home-cooked food and good value for money are two qualities that come through consistently in guest feedback.
Club Spirit & Atmosphere
Despite the modest size of both the club and the village, Club Esportiu Campanet has a strong team spirit — with well-trained coaches and staff and an active football scene. The sports centre is a great fit for families and anyone keen to keep active in the area.
Location & Surroundings
The club is located at Carrer Camí Vell d'Inca 11 in Campanet, on the outskirts of the village and easy to reach.
